CBE - Industrial Laboratory System

Basic Technical features: AC input: 3 x 400V +/- 10% – 50Hz. DC voltage up to 250V. Zero battery Volt in discharge available with appropriate booster circuit. DC current up to 100A in charge or discharge mode. Duty Cycle: 100% in charge or discharge mode; @ maximum current rate. Output ripple negligible. Efficiency 0,77 typ. Power factor 0,9 typ. T.H.D 12% or less than 10% with appropriate filter. Transition time. From CH to DISCH. 130 milliseconds. Cooling: by forced air (fans). Ambient temperature up to 45°C. Protection grade IP 21. POWERMOSFETs linear regulation; no significant ripple figures on the D.C. output. The minimum dischargeable batteries voltage is also dependent of the circuit voltage drops. The modular CYTEST – LR system is an innovative product designed for automotive/industrial batteries testing for laboratory applications. The POWERMOS technologies allows to reduce the ripple current down to zero and allows better measures accuracy.

CBE - Grid Caster

The 24SP Grid Caster was developed to handle almost all alloy casting needs at realistic speeds of 12 to 18 casts per minute for 3.2mm down to 1 mm grid thickness. All features, from lead dispensing to grid stacking, are automatic. The 24SP is totally electric heated and self-contained. Cast grids are automatically aligned parallel to center of trim die and power fed in and out of trim die. (Die cooling available.) Mold spraying systems provide clean filtered air free of oil and water for both mold spray gun and vent bars.

CBE - Oxide Ball Mill & Filter

The Ball Mill is suitable to produce lead oxide by means of friction between the cylinders produced before by the cylinder casting machine (Shimadzu method). Six parts compose it: Rotating room. It is made of steel, welded on the generatrix and mechanically worked, in order to enable the assembling using hubs, on which the ball bearings are assembled. Base and supports. The rotating room is supported by an electrically welded structural steel.

CBE - Lead Cylinder Casting Machine

The cylinder casting machine is studied to produce lead cylinders. Base. A strong steel framework enables to support the spheroid cast iron crown and the pinion. Spheroid crown: made of melting cast iron in which are machined 120 cavities. The cavities are filled with melted lead and finally cylinders are ejected vertically. Cylinder extraction system: made of 120 steel ejectors, which slide inside the crown cavity. The slide handling of the ejectors is assured by the ball bearings, which slide on a reversible cam.

CBE - Acid Dilution Preparation & Retitration Plant

The dilution plant has been projected and built for an easy and fast use and to get results of good precision. The dilution happens in a mixing tank where water and sulphuric acid are dosed. The dosage of these liquids is gotten in ponder way, through the software that prepares the quantity of water and acid with the density for defect, since in this phase of filling the feeding of the liquids is coarsely performed for decreasing its times.

CBE - Enveloping/Stacking Unit

The EN 130/I enveloping/stacking unit is an uncompromisingly sturdy machine assembled on a machine frame work. The machine is designed and manufactured in order to operate in line with C.O.S. equipment and undertakes, in automatic cycle, the following operations: cutting of the separators in any desired length with one bending line in the middle of the same separator, in order to facilitate the folding operation feeding of the plate into the separator welding of the separators by pressure stacking of the enveloped and no-enveloped plates accumulation of the combined plates in vertical position.
